Kiara Advani is being trolled for her scenes with Yash in ‘Tabaahi’, a song from the upcoming movie ‘Toxic’. Netizens have been making sexist remarks against the actress, asking why a married woman and mother would do such scenes. But Yash, who is also married and is a father, hasn’t received the same kind of hate for the same scenes.
Reacting to this, Huma Qureshi said the women from the film will have the last laugh once it comes out, basically saying the movie itself will shut down the critics.
Speaking on Yuvaa’s ‘Be A Man, Yaar!’, the host brought up how Kiara faced far more backlash for her intimate scenes in ‘Tabaahi’ compared to Yash, even though both actors are married. Responding to this, Huma said, “It’s sick. It’s disgusting, absolutely. But I think women in this film, the actresses and the directors, will have the last laugh. There’s no point in trying to defend something at all because you can’t change people’s mindset with words. I would just let the film do the talking. Who are these people? I think the world is a very kind place, but the internet is not.”
Kiara has been dealing with a wave of criticism and rude comments ever since ‘Tabaahi’, the debut song from Yash’s ‘Toxic’, dropped online. Trolls extended their attacks to her husband, Sidharth Malhotra, flooding his Instagram with similar remarks.
What started out as criticism of Kiara’s professional choices soon turned into unwanted commentary on her personal life, her marriage and her bond with Sidharth.
